YES! Brisbane Pride Choir: 20 years on stage


The Brisbane Pride Choir has shared songs and stories around Australia and the world since 1998. That’s 20 years of spreading love through music.

And to think: homosexuality was unlawful in Queensland until 1990. The choir will celebrate its 20th anniversary and the historic ‘yes’ vote at Brisbane Powerhouse on 17 May, alongside special guests Lucinda Shaw, Candy Surprise, Dawn Daylight, Mary Jane Carpenter and Petit Four.

The night will feature a range of music, from modern mash-ups (I Will Survive/Survivor) to classic ballads (Somewhere Over the Rainbow and My Island Home), performed by both current and former singers from the choir.

This event will feature an Auslan interpreter.
